How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Los Palos?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Los Palos Studio Apartments | $1,950 | $1,950 | $1,950 |
| Los Palos 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,682 | $2,050 | $3,573 |
| Los Palos 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,049 | $2,420 | $4,413 |
| Los Palos 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,253 | $3,225 | $3,310 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Los Palos
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Los Palos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Los Palos ranges from $2,050 to $3,573 with an average monthly rent of $2,682.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Los Palos c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Los Palos range from $2,420 to $4,413.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,049.
How expensive are Los Palos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 7 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Los Palos on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,225 to $3,310 - averaging $3,253 for the location.
